Key Nutrition Facts about Quaker Quaker Oat Life Plain
FAQ's
What are the protein, carbohydrate, and fat contents in 100 grams of 'Quaker Quaker Oat Life Plain'?
100 grams of 'Quaker Quaker Oat Life Plain' contains approximately following amounts of protein, carbohydrates, and fat:
Protein – 10g (around 20% of daily requirement),
Carbohydrates – 78g (around 28% of daily requirement),
Fat – 4g (around 5% of daily requirement).
It is typically higher in Carbohydrates while lower in Fat, making it more suitable for diets that are high-carb and also suitable for those requiring low Fat intake.
How many calories are in 100 grams of 'Quaker Quaker Oat Life Plain'?
A 100-gram serving of 'Quaker Quaker Oat Life Plain' provides around 374 kcal of energy. The majority of the calories come from carbohydrates, based on its macronutrient composition. This contributes approximately 19% of an average 2000 kcal daily diet, making it a calorie-dense food choice.
Is 'Quaker Quaker Oat Life Plain' mainly a source of protein, carbohydrates, or fat?
In 100g, 'Quaker Quaker Oat Life Plain' is mainly a source of carbohydrates. It contains 10g protein, 78g carbs, and 4g fat, making it suitable for diets focused on carbohydrates.
